### Runbook: Report export timezone mismatches (Glimmerfield)

If a customer reports that exported totals differ from the dashboard, check whether their report schedule predates the March cutover — older schedules still render in server-local time rather than the account timezone. Re-saving the schedule fixes it. Before escalating, confirm the export worker is running with the expected timezone settings shown below.

config for kadup-kajog:
[raldor]
host = raldor.tolvaqworks.internal
user = raldor_svc
database = raldor_prod

// REINDEX_BATCH_CAP limits docs per shard pass in the Tallowfield
// nightly search reindex. Raising it starves the ingest queue;
// lowering it overruns the maintenance window. 5000 is the tested
// sweet spot. Change only with a soak run. Verified against the
// build noted below.

session token of bawif-hahog = htk6_ac5981

Handover note — Mailcadence digest scheduler

Hey, whoever picks this up: the digest scheduler is mostly stable, but watch the Sunday batch — it overlaps with the Oakbine cleanup job and occasionally starves. I've been meaning to stagger them but never got to it. Timezone handling is per-subscriber, not per-batch, which surprises everyone. The scheduler currently runs with these values in production.

deployment values, kajep-kageg:
[praix]
host = praix.paliqcorp.corp
user = praix_svc
database = praix_prod

MEMO — Finance Team

We have received the draft term sheet from Halvorsen Tidal Partners regarding the proposed minority stake in our Brightmere division. Headline valuation is in line with our internal model, but the liquidation preference is 1.5x participating, and the anti-dilution clause is full ratchet rather than weighted average. Please review the covenant schedule carefully before Friday's call with their counsel. The strategic rationale is summarised below for context.

management briefing: Project Ulavan slips by two quarters because of the staffing delay.